Summary

Bandwidth is a crucial factor to consider when choosing a web host, as excessive traffic can lead to slower load times, website crashes, or overage fees. To calculate bandwidth usage, developers must estimate page weight, average pageviews per day, and downloadable content. A simple equation calculates the required bandwidth by multiplying these factors with a redundant factor of 1.5. Optimizing for bandwidth involves reducing page weight through image optimizations, caching settings, lazy loading images, and monitoring optimizations. Some web hosts, like Netlify, offer increased bandwidth limits in their plans to minimize overage fees.
